Re: White mould on Lithops seed
Spray some water on the 'mould'. If it is really mould, it would clump together due to the drups. And you should be able to remove them gently with the tip of a knife. If they are roots, they will stay as they are, but just wet.

Re: White mould on Lithops seed
I don't know what you think to see, but I don't see mould. I see lot's of little roots finding their way down into the soil.
I ususally help the plants out: grabbing a pointy knife, stab the soil to make a nice hole and place the roots gently into the hole, then pushing the soil back.

Re: Watering while on holiday
Just leave them without water. They are succulents, even the one year olds can easily survive a few weeks if not months without water, as antisepp says.
